开发者社区> 问答> 正文

主机运行时生成快照是什么样的

在主机运行中(windows主机),生成系统盘快照,但不生成数据盘快照。那么如果用快照来恢复,是不是直接机器就是运行中的?如果当时操作系统中运行了若干个软件,恢复后这些软件还是生成快照前的状态吗?
区分两种情况来问吧:
情况1、例如生成快照时,正在运行一个系统程序(例如正在播放音乐),那么回滚快照后,音乐会从生成快照时接着播放吗?
情况2、生成快照时,正运行QQ软件,但QQ软件时安装在数据盘的,生成快照后,把QQ关闭,并卸载QQ软件。由于QQ已不存在于数据盘商,回滚快照后可能会出现什么问题?

展开
收起
lecture 2014-04-09 22:05:53 7026 0
4 条回答
写回答
取消 提交回答
  • Re主机运行时生成快照是什么样的
    东风破分析的有理。

    那么如果系统正在运行中,生成的快照会不会可能有问题。就好比计算机突然断电,在硬盘不坏的情况下,重启计算机,仍然会提示系统非正常退出的。
    2014-04-10 18:54:27
    赞同 展开评论 打赏
  • 你懂的!
    2014-04-10 13:52:10
    赞同 展开评论 打赏
  • Re主机运行时生成快照是什么样的
    快照只是对磁盘在某个时间点的数据的一个拷贝。当时系统运行的程序,状态是在内存里的,所以不会被记录到快照中。

    但有一种情况,例如你使用了windows的休眠,windows会把内存的状态拷贝到磁盘上。做完休眠,再去打快照的话,理论上你从这个快照做成镜像再启动新的服务器,就可以直接运行当时的程序了。
    2014-04-10 12:27:07
    赞同 展开评论 打赏
  • 快照就是个本地电脑备份系统一样,当你备份的时候是什么状态,恢复就是什么状态。对于你的情况下,歌曲是否播放,本人没这样操作过,你可以试试看,恢复后是否接着播放,按理论恢复快照后是会播放的。情况2就是不一个情况的对比了,你生产快照是对系统盘,而你卸载安装在数据盘的QQ软件,你恢复了肯定是不行的吧,毕竟软件都卸载了,而你单独的备份快照是对系统盘而作的。
    可以肯定的告诉你一点,备份快照的时候,网站的软件都是工作的,恢复后都是工作的,建议N个盘,就同时备份N个盘,这样对于任何数据都是有利的,不会出现A盘和B盘数据接不上的问题。
    2014-04-09 23:39:35
    赞同 展开评论 打赏
问答分类:
问答地址:
问答排行榜
最热
最新

相关电子书

更多
运用新技术解决有状态应用的冷热迁移挑战 迁移策略+新容器运行时 立即下载
低代码开发师(初级)实战教程 立即下载
阿里巴巴DevOps 最佳实践手册 立即下载